This remixed PSU-cover model provides a cutout for a USB connector and extra space inside for a DC-DC step-down voltage converter, turning the PSU's 24V into the 5V needed for USB.
This is especially useful if you want to add a camera (like @ManelTo's Esp32 camera) as it will only power the camera when the printer is on!
Extra parts I used:
I'd recommend using spade connectors, and slightly bending them near the base. This will ensure the existing connectors on the PSU can remain tightly secured once you connect these additional ones.
